Webb16 mars 2016 · Achernar is considered a main sequence star and shines a hot blueish color. It is six to eight times more massive than the Sun and eight to ten times the diameter of the Sun. In addition, Achernar is also a very fast spinner, completing a rotation every two days. For this reason, Achernar is flattened and its poles are hotter than its equator ... Webb5 mars 2016 · Fixed star Achernar, Alpha Eridani, is a 0.5 magnitude blue-white star located in the Mouth of the River, Eridanus Constellation. The traditional name Achernar comes from the Arabic phrase آخر النه ر (ākhir an-nahr) which means The End of the River . Webb12 juli 2024 · Facts about Achernar. The distance from Achernar to earth is 144 light years. It has 6-8 solar masses and belongs as main sequence star to the spectral class B6. The luminosity of Achernar exceeds that of the sun by three thousand times. Its surface temperature is 20,000 K. In addition, Achenar is a binary star, in which its companion …

Achernar is the brightest star in the constellation of Eridanus, and the ninth-brightest in the night sky. It has the Bayer designation Alpha Eridani, which is Latinized from α Eridani and abbreviated Alpha Eri or α Eri. The name Achernar applies to the primary component of a binary system.
